Kasturi Orange Juice


Kasturi orange is one of the most popular oranges in Indonesia, known as key orange or calamansi orange. Now this orange itself has a small shape and also has a fresh sour taste with very little sweetness. The most typical of this orange is its fragrant aroma when processed into anything.

Ingredients Used


20250825_101443.jpg


5 Kasturi oranges
4 tablespoons sugar
500 ml mineral water




Making Procedure


First I prepare the kasturi orange then split it into two parts, let all the seeds you remove so that the drink is not bitter later
.


20250825_101448.jpg

20250825_101541.jpg

20250825_101518.jpg

20250825_101820.jpg


After all the seeds are in the fruit I add the oranges to the blender then add sugar.


20250825_101858.jpg20250825_101904.jpg20250825_101915.jpg

Finally add water then juice in the blender until everything blends perfectly. No need to strain you just prepare in a glass serving add ice cubes or can be dimpan in the refrigerator.


20250825_101950.jpg20250825_101921.jpg20250825_102033.jpg



Result


20250825_111900.jpg

Kasturi orange juice is ready to enjoy, enjoy it while it is cold you will feel an extraordinary sensation. The sweetness and most importantly the tartness of the orange is just right. The peel does not make the drink bitter and tart, instead with the presence of the peel the aroma is even more distinctive.
